#e82d96 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e82d96 is composed of 91% red, 17.6%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 35.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 326.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 54.3%. #e82d96 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#d1002d.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#e82d96 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e82d96 has RGB values of R:232, G:45,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.35,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15216022.

Hex triplet e82d96 #e82d96
RGB Decimal 232, 45, 150 rgb(232,45,150)
RGB Percent 91, 17.6, 58.8 rgb(91%,17.6%,58.8%)
CMYK 0, 81, 35, 9
HSL 326.3°, 80.3, 54.3 hsl(326.3,80.3%,54.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 326.3°, 80.6, 91
Web Safe ff3399 #ff3399
CIE-LAB 53.21, 75.51, -12.047
XYZ 39.723, 21.239, 30.86
xyY 0.433, 0.231, 21.239
CIE-LCH 53.21, 76.465, 350.935
CIE-LUV 53.21, 106.914, -30.71
Hunter-Lab 46.085, 73.208, -7.443
Binary 11101000, 00101101, 10010110

Shades and Tints of #e82d96

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e82d96

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e878b is the less saturated color, while #fa1b98 is the most saturated one.
